2 months ago, it cost me i think, 490.4ytl for the year at the tax office, 20ytl at the Muhtars, 10ytl i think for the computer written forms that the marina police give you when you think you have got everything, but you don't have far to travel for that, it's about 40yds down from where they give you the forms, but make sure you get there about 11-00 or you will have to hang around, 75+3.5ytl at the post office and all the photocopies cost approx. 15ytl, it is cheaper to go to Meis and get your duty free at the same time as have a nice day out, but you need residency for certain things that you can't get with a 3mth visa.
